使用Python Pandas库取Dataframe的第一行数据
在数据分析和处理过程中,经常需要处理大量的数据。Python的Pandas库是一个强大的工具,可以帮助我们高效地处理和分析数据。在Pandas中,DataFrame是一个非常常用的数据结构,它类似于Excel中的二维表格,我们可以对其进行各种操作和处理。
在本文中,我将向您展示如何使用Python Pandas库来获取DataFrame的第一行数据。我将介绍如何创建DataFrame对象以及如何使用函数来取得第一行数据。
创建DataFrame对象
在开始之前,我们需要先创建一个DataFrame对象。我们可以通过多种方式来创建DataFrame,如从列表、字典、CSV文件或数据库中读取等。这里我将使用列表来创建一个简单的DataFrame。
import pandas as pd
data = [['Alice', 25], ['Bob', 30], ['Charlie', 35]]
df = pd.DataFrame(data, columns=['Name', 'Age'])
上述代码中,我们首先导入了Pandas库,并使用一个名为data
的列表来存储数据。然后,我们使用pd.DataFrame()
函数将列表转换为DataFrame对象,并指定了列名为Name
和Age
。
取得第一行数据
一旦我们创建了DataFrame对象,就可以使用head()
函数来获取DataFrame的前几行数据。在这里,我们只需要获取第一行数据,所以我们可以将head()
函数的参数设置为1。
first_row = df.head(1)
上面的代码将返回一个新的DataFrame对象,其中只包含原始DataFrame的第一行数据。我们可以使用print()
函数来查看这个数据。
print(first_row)
输出结果如下:
Name Age
0 Alice 25
结论
通过以上步骤,我们成功地取得了DataFrame的第一行数据。使用Python Pandas库,我们可以轻松地进行数据的处理和分析。DataFrame对象提供了众多的函数和方法,可以帮助我们高效地操作和处理数据。
希望本文对您理解如何使用Python Pandas库来获取DataFrame的第一行数据有所帮助。如果您有任何疑问,请随时提问。
附录
代码
import pandas as pd
data = [['Alice', 25], ['Bob', 30], ['Charlie', 35]]
df = pd.DataFrame(data, columns=['Name', 'Age'])
first_row = df.head(1)
print(first_row)
引用
- [Pandas官方文档](
- [Pandas入门教程](
- [Pandas教程](
饼状图示例
使用mermaid语法中的pie标识绘制一个简单的饼状图:
pie
"A": 40
"B": 30
"C": 20
"D": 10
以上代码将绘制一个饼状图,其中"A"占40%,"B"占30%,"C"占20%,"D"占10%。